| Version | Text |
| Hebrew | אל־תרא יין כי יתאדם כי־יתן עינו יתהלך במישרים׃ |
| Greek | μη μεθυσκεσθε οινω αλλα ομιλειτε ανθρωποις δικαιοις και ομιλειτε εν περιπατοις εαν γαρ εις τας φιαλας και τα ποτηρια δως τους οφθαλμους σου υστερον περιπατησεις γυμνοτερος |
| Latin | Ne intuearis vinum quando flavescit, cum splenduerit in vitro color ejus : ingreditur blande, |
| KJV | Look not thou upon the wine when it is red, when it giveth his colour in the cup, when it moveth itself aright. |
| WEB | Don't look at the wine when it is red, when it sparkles in the cup, when it goes down smoothly. |
